Web30 jan. 2024 · Moreover, if the files exceed the size limits of destination drive file system, you’ll be incapable of saving them as well. Most USB flash drives are FAT32 formatted. FAT32 has a shortcoming that it only supports a single file up to 4GB in maximum size. Thereby, if you’re trying to save a file larger than 4GB, you will definitely file.
